Output 2bf80fe2c14e8584a714ded8fdbf75e6941c20b167f23389a59e93dc59e03e4e:5

value
20240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c18ec090f8f656ec674e516d3c54be78227120 OP_EQUAL
address
3E4q24TghSKrZnzAtB9Ec3bmniYsvoqMV7
transaction
2bf80fe2c14e8584a714ded8fdbf75e6941c20b167f23389a59e93dc59e03e4e
spent
true